Plague | Arnold Böcklin | 1898 Tivadar Csontváry-Kosztka dressed in dark clothing andAbout the artwork: Arnold Bcklins Plague (1898) is a dark and harrowing depiction of the devastation wrought by pestilence, blending allegory with visceral imagery. The painting features a spectral, winged figure astride a skeletal horse, galloping through a city as it spreads death and chaos.
